FIRE/EMS INSTRUCTOR
- GENERAL DESCRIPTION
This position serves as an evaluator or instructor for fire/EMS Training. Personnel in this position should be able to effectively communicate lesson plans in a variety of settings to include classroom and practical settings.
- 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S
- The ability to communicate in both oral and written forms to students.
- Provide Fire/EMS training instruction to new recruits both volunteer and career.
- Prepare lesson plans for both didactic and practical settings.
- Provide support to training and administrative staff during practical testing.
- Assess potential applicants during promotional assessment centers.
- Maintain accurate class records and personal records as they pertain to documenting hours worked.
- Must adhere to all applicable Roanoke County and Roanoke County Fire and Rescue Department polices and procedures.
- REQUIREMENTS/PREFERENCES
- EducationRequired: Current Virginia Department of Fire Programs Instructor 1 certification or higher, graduation from high school or the equivalent.Preferred: Current Virginia Department of Fire Programs Instructor 2 Certification, Associates Degree or higher from an Accredited College or University. Current Virginia Emergency Medical Technician –Basic Certification.ExperienceRequired: Three years of documented experience in the fire service as a firefighter or above.Preferred: Three years of documented experience as a certified fire instructor. Five years of documented experience in the fire service as a firefighter and three years documented experience as a fire officer.Certifications/ LicensesRequired: Current Virginia Department of Fire Programs Instructor 1.Valid Virginia Drivers License with zero points or positive points.Additional RequirementsSubject to a complete criminal history and Child Protective Services background search with acceptable results. Good physical condition. Following a conditional offer of employment, must pass a post offer physical examination. Must be able to perform the job as described in the Physical and Environmental Demands section of this job description.Supervisory ResponsibilitiesSupervise students while in training
